Étape 1: Ce que je parle ?
Les nrLF2401 et les variantes sont un émetteur/récepteur 2,4 Ghz (radio) qui est capable des transmettre et recevoir un flux de données de paquets. C’est un excellent endroit pour commencer si vous voulez travailler avec les radios étant donnés le nombre relativement faible des registres de contrôle qui doivent être programmées pour la plupart des cas, le flux d’exploitation simple et le petit investissement nécessaire. (< un dolla). Comme avec la plupart des émetteurs-récepteurs, celui-ci utilise le bus SPI pour vous connecter à votre plateforme de calcul. Il y a plus cher et plus compliqués radios là-bas, mais vous pouvez faire beaucoup avec celui-ci. Vous aurez besoin de deux d'entre eux et calculer les deux plates-formes pour expérimenter. J’utilise un module Arduino Pro Mini que j’ai accumuler pendant la majeure partie de mon jeu, mais j’ai mis cette radio sur plusieurs autres plates-formes plus récents comme le D2000 Intel (quark2) et le ESP8266 sans aucun problème. Je publierai un autre instructable sur ces autres plates-formes peu de temps pour documenter ce que j’ai fait. En outre, comme je vais aborder plus en détail plus tard (il s’agit d’un plug éhonté d’autres instructables), j’ai également créé un C et C++, version bang (aucun spi contrôleur nécessaire, seulement cinq broches e/s) bit complet de ce que je considère pour être la seule bibliothèque de pilote, vous avez besoin si vous travaillez avec un Arduino. J’ai cela couvrira également dans un autre instructable.
Voici un clip de la première page de la trousse de fiche de données de nrLF2401(+). Cela vous donne une idée des capacités radios.